



Ross “Babe” Parisi, 75, of Steubenville, Ohio died Friday, May 22, 2009 at his home with his family by his side. He was born October 15, 1933 in Steubenville, OH a son of the late Domenic and Donata Vernacchio Parisi. Babe was a member of Holy Rosary Catholic Church and an Air Force veteran serving during the Korean War. He began working in casinos in Las Vegas at the age of seventeen, worked in casinos overseas and finished his career at Mountaineer Race Track and Gaming Resort.
